Meg’s Reviews > Saving Noah > Status Update

Meg
Meg is 17% done
Nov 06, 2025 06:58PM
Saving Noah

flag

Meg’s Previous Updates

Meg
Meg is 77% done
Nov 11, 2025 04:25AM
Saving Noah


Meg
Meg is 65% done
Nov 10, 2025 05:43PM
Saving Noah


Meg
Meg is 22% done
Nov 07, 2025 07:32PM
Saving Noah


No comments have been added yet.